LULA LOVES TREES

Brazilian voters have ousted their climate-killing president, Jair Bolsonaro, in favor of Lula de Silva. Lula is a long-time defender of the Amazon Rainforest and protecting the Indigenous Peoples who live within. A win for Lula is a win for the trees.

COOL IT

President Biden has formalized an agreement restricting Hydrofluorocarbons (HFCs), a major greenhouse gas contributor, used mostly in refrigerants and cooling appliances.

E-WASTE NOT WASTED

Electronic waste is one of the most difficult types of trash to dispose of, but a Nigerian-based company, Quadloop, has a plan to convert it into solar-powered lanterns.

ARE WE THERE YET?

The International Energy Agency anticipates carbon emissions from energy will peak in 2025, and then decline.

MAGIC SCHOOL BUS

The Biden administration dedicated $1 billion towards electrifying school buses. This will reduce climate pollution and protect children from toxic chemicals.

EU’S EV FUTURE

EU negotiators reached a landmark deal to phase out the sale of gasoline-powered cars by 2035. They agreed automakers must achieve a 100 percent reduction in greenhouse gas emissions from new cars sold.

COLORADO RIVER CUTS

The Interior Department has signaled it might reduce the amount of water released from the Hoover and Glen Canyon dams over the next couple years as the Colorado River faces epic drought conditions and reservoirs dry up.

1 DEATH EVERY 2 DAYS

Defending the environment can be life-threatening. A new report reveals more than 1,700 people have been murdered in the past decade because of their environmental activism.
